Lawyers for Donald Trump have asked a federal judge to prevent the FBI from continuing to review documents recovered earlier this month from the former United States president’s Florida home, until a neutral “special master” is appointed to inspect the records.The request was included in a court filing on Monday, the first by Trump’s legal team since the search at Mar-a-Lago on August 8, that takes broad aim at the FBI investigation into the discovery of classified records from the estate.The motion, filed in federal court in West Palm Beach, Florida, also asked investigators to return any items outside the scope of the search warrant.
